The only thing you will need to be aware of is the fact that the oil can desensitize you if you use it in pure doses directly on your skin.
It is not a good idea to use it pure; the oil will need to be diluted with a carrier oil to be sure you are not going to burn your skin. Essential oils must be used with caution, especially in its pure form.
Carrier Oils for Tea Tree Oil
A few carrier oils that is necessary to mix with the tea tree oil are coconut oil, olive oil or jajoba oil. These oils will help to take the oil deeper into the skin. Deeper to where the scabies, female mite burrows itself.
